First and foremost, it is crucial for us to be aware of our surroundings at all times. Whether we are walking down a dark alley or simply walking to our cars at night, being alert and conscious of our environment can make all the difference. Trust your instincts – if something feels off, don’t hesitate to remove yourself from the situation.
One of the most effective self-defense techniques for women is learning how to defend yourself against potential attackers. This can be done through martial arts classes, self-defense workshops, or even online tutorials. By learning basic moves such as strikes, kicks, and blocks, you can significantly increase your chances of escaping a dangerous situation unharmed.
Additionally, it is important for us to utilize personal protection devices such as pepper spray, tasers, or personal alarms. These tools can provide us with a sense of security and can deter potential attackers from approaching us. Remember, it is always better to be safe than sorry.
I also highly recommend investing in a self-defense keychain or tool that can be easily carried with you at all times. These small, discreet devices can be a lifesaver in emergency situations and can give you the upper hand against an attacker.
Lastly, remember that self-defense is not just about physical protection – it is also about mental and emotional strength. Practice assertiveness and set boundaries with those around you. Be confident in yourself and your abilities, and know that you are capable of protecting yourself in any situation.

Breaking Stereotypes: How Legal Bodyguards are Changing the Game for Women
In a world where security has always been perceived as a male-dominated field, women are now stepping up to break the glass ceiling. Legal bodyguards are redefining perceptions of strength, professionalism, and capability, and they are doing it with grace and efficacy.
The Rise of Female Bodyguards
Historically, bodyguard roles have been associated with physical strength and aggressive demeanors. However, women in this profession are proving that skill, intelligence, and emotional intelligence are equally essential. The rise of female bodyguards reflects a significant cultural shift, demonstrating that women can effectively protect individuals, especially in legal settings.
Redefining Strength
Strength is no longer just about physical prowess; it encompasses awareness, communication, and intuition. Female bodyguards often excel in de-escalation and negotiation, skills that are particularly beneficial in legal environments where tension can run high. By focusing on conflict resolution, women are proving that there is more than one way to ensure safety.
Changing Stereotypes
As women take on roles traditionally held by men, they challenge ingrained stereotypes. Each successful operation or client engagement contributes to redefining societal views of women in security roles. When clients see women confidently managing security protocols, it inspires confidence and respect and encourages others to recognize women’s capabilities in various domains.
Empowering Others
Female bodyguards serve as role models not only to aspiring security professionals but also to women across different industries. They embody empowerment, showing that with the right training and mindset, women can thrive in any role. Their presence inspires other women to pursue careers that may have seemed out of reach due to societal norms.
The Future of Security
As more women enter the field, the security landscape is set to evolve. Legal bodyguards will continue to advocate for inclusivity, further changing perceptions about women in leadership roles. This shift is vital in making the industry more diverse and representative, ultimately leading to better security practices.
Conclusion
Breaking stereotypes is a gradual process, but the rise of female legal bodyguards is a significant step forward. They are changing the game by demonstrating that professionalism, competence, and strength can come in all shapes and sizes. As society progresses, we can look forward to a future where women in bodyguard roles are not just accepted but celebrated.
